I'm looking to replace the gasket in my hard top rear window.
I've looked at:
1st. CASCO. They sell 2.
1st is made in USA for $60.00. Out of stock with no idea when they will get any
2nd is not made in USA for about $45.00. No explanation of the difference.

2nd. Hill's. They sell 1 for about $32.00. No idea where its made or how it compares to the others.

3rd. NPD. They sell 2.
1st is $25.00
2nd is much like CASCO only less expensive. It's made in USA for $45.00. Out of stock. No idea when it will be in.

My question is has anyone used any of these weather strips and have you had any problems.
